Design Synthesis and Characterisation of Silver Nanoparticals using Dracaena Trifasciata Extracts
Author(s) | Ganesan |
---|---|
Country | India |
Abstract | Eco-friendly silver nanoparticle AgNPs biosynthesised from the ethanolic extract of the Dracaena trifasciata plant. The UV ether analytical approach is used to analyze the biosynthesis of silver nanoparticles.Using ascorbic acid (vit C)as a standard, prepare silver nanoparticles were examined for their in vitro antioxidant properties using DPPH. Additionally, they were not treated for their in vitro anti-inflammatory properties using the denaturation protein test with diclofenac sodium as the standard.The creation of silver nanoparticles during biosynthesis is indicated by a color shift from colorless to reddish brown ,with maximum absorption occurring at 459 nm [0.441 OD].Comparing DT AgNPs to standard under comparable condition showed no anti-inflammatory action and a strong antioxidant effect.These in-vitro data suitable for in-vivo animal studies. |
